Hi,
I'm going to enter the US on the CR visa but in 4 weeks will celebrate my second anniversary. The officer said that I need to file an adjustment the day after my second anniversary. I don't want to wait to enter because I have a job lined up and don't want to be separated any longer...

Has anyone done this and know how long on average it takes? Also, what forms and is there a cost?

Thanks...

Don't know about what the "officier" is talking about. Normally CRs have to file to remove conditions [I-751] within 90 days before 2 year expiration date of receipt of green card.

There is no such thing.... if you enter before your second wedding anniversary you are going to get a 2 year greencard (CR1)... you will then have to file to remove the conditions 90 days before the expiry of that card at a cost of $545.00... if you wait until the day after your second wedding anniversary to enter you will get a 10 year greencard (IR1) and will have nothing to file until 90 days before expiry of that card... if it was me I would wait that extra 4 weeks...
